【问题标题】:Passing parameter via Azure Databricks Notebook URL通过 Azure Databricks Notebook URL 传递参数
【发布时间】:2021-03-18 16:05:37
【问题描述】:

所以我的要求如下:

我有一个包含 ID 列表的 PowerBI 报告,我想通过 ADB python 笔记本 URL 将该 ID 作为参数传递。我将创建一个度量,它将 ID 附加到 ADB 笔记本 URL 的末尾,当用户单击 URL 时,他们将被定向到 ADB 笔记本。在 ADB 笔记本中,我将从 url 获取 ID 并根据特定 ID 进行数据操作。任何更好的方法来完成这项任务,我尝试在 ADB 笔记本末尾附加 ID,但这似乎不是一个理想的解决方案。

任何建议都会有所帮助。

注意:我不想直接将数据获取到 PowerBI,一切都需要在 ADB 本身中完成。

【问题讨论】:

    标签: python azure powerbi adb databricks


    【解决方案1】:

    当我需要将参数传递给 Databricks 笔记本时,我会使用小部件。通常我使用数据工厂传递参数。我从来没有用 Power BI 做过。您可以使用以下代码创建一个简单的小部件

    dbutils.widgets.dropdown("X", "1", [str(x) for x in range(1, 10)])
    

    您也可以使用代码查看文档

    dbutils.widgets.help()
    

    【讨论】:

    • 问题是关于通过 URL 传递参数,小部件用于不同的东西
    猜你喜欢
    • 1970-01-01
    • 2022-01-16
    • 2014-05-22
    • 1970-01-01
    • 2023-04-08
    • 1970-01-01
    • 1970-01-01
    • 2022-01-22
    • 1970-01-01
    相关资源
    最近更新 更多